Why are fiberglass boats hard to dispose of in Naperville?
Fiberglass boat disposal in Naperville, Illinois runs between $400 and $1,500 depending on hull length and condition, and DuPage County's transfer stations won't accept fiberglass hulls as standard solid waste. That's not a technicality. Fiberglass is a thermoset composite, meaning the glass fibers and resin are permanently bonded and can't be broken down through ordinary landfill processing. Naperville boat owners who keep a hull at a slip on the DuPage River corridor or in storage near the Fox River face ongoing slip fees and fines while they figure out what to do. Illinois boat disposal laws also require hazardous materials like fuel, batteries, and engine fluids to be drained before any scrap or salvage operation begins. Does the Naperville landfill take fiberglass boats?
DuPage County's waste facilities don't accept fiberglass hulls. Fiberglass is a thermoset composite, meaning it can't be melted down or broken apart the way standard construction debris can. Most regional landfills reject it outright because of the resins and foam core material inside. How much does fiberglass boat disposal cost in Naperville, IL?
Hansons Boat Removal prices fiberglass disposal in Naperville between $400 and $1,500. Hull length drives the base cost, but foam core density, leftover fuel or fluids, and site access all push the number up or down. A 20-foot hull with no fluids and driveway access typically lands toward the lower end. Hansons Boat Removal gives you an exact quote before any work starts.
